Ingredients Homemade Wasabi Mayonnaise
- Wasabi Paste - Besides wasabi, this paste contains a bit of horseradish. Both ingredients give a spicy and intense flavor.
- Sour cream - it’s a thick and sour tasting cream and contains between 10 and 20 % milk fats. You can use it in cold sauces.
Ingredients Homemade Garlic Mayonnaise (Aioli)
- Garlic - Of course, garlic mayonnaise contains garlic. It gives this mayonnaise its flavor.
- Lemon juice - Every Aioli needs some lemon juice. Use fresh for the best flavor.
Ingredients Homemade Pesto Mayonnaise
- Pesto - Make your own basil pesto or use a good store-bought. The pesto gives this mayonnaise a bit of a sweet and basil flavor.
Ingredients Homemade Saffron Mayonnaise
- Saffron - A sweet, grassy, and floral flavor. It will give yellow color to the mayonnaise. Saffron is widely used in Persian, Indian, European, and Arab cuisine. In these cuisines, it’s used both sweet and savory dishes. Unfortunately, it’s an expensive spice.
- Sour cream - it’s a thick and sour cream. It contains between 10 and 20 % milk fats. You can use it in cold sauces.
Ingredients Homemade Yogurt Mayonnaise Sauce
- Yogurt - Use Greek Yogurt for this sauce. It’s creamy and thick, precisely how you want this sauce.
- Olive oil - To give this sauce a fruity flavor and a silky taste.
How to prepare 5 Flavors of Mayonnaise
You can find a printable recipe with a step-by-step description at the bottom of this blog.
Easy Wasabi Mayonnaise
- Put all the ingredients in a bowl.
- Stir everything and taste. Add some extra wasabi, salt, and pepper when needed.
Easy Homemade Garlic Mayonnaise (Aioli)
- Squeeze the cloves of garlic and lemon in a small bowl and add the mayonnaise.
- Give the ingredients a good stir and taste. Add salt, pepper, and/or lemon juice when needed.
Easy Homemade Pesto Mayonnaise
- Add the pesto and mayonnaise to a bowl.
- Combine the two ingredients until smooth.
Easy Homemade Saffron Mayonnaise
- Take a small bowl and add saffron, mayonnaise, and sour cream.
- Stir, and season with salt and pepper to taste. Let it marinate for at least 1 hour in the refrigerator.
Easy Homemade Yogurt Mayonnaise Sauce
- Pour some olive oil into a bowl and add the yogurt and mayonnaise.
- Whisk all the ingredients and flavor with salt and pepper.

Ingredients
- ½ cup mayonnaise
- ½ teaspoon wasabi paste
- 2 tablespoons sour cream
- salt and pepper to taste
Ingredients you need per step are listed below the step in Italic
Instructions
Stir all ingredients together and taste.
½ cup mayonnaise, ½ teaspoon wasabi paste, 2 tablespoons sour cream
Season with salt, pepper and, if necessary. If you like a bit more spice, use extra wasabi.
salt and pepper
Notes
1. -Storage
Always store the mayonnaise in the refrigerator in an airtight container. This keeps it good for up to 3 days.
